A quick and easy jalapeño pepper jelly recipe using water bath canning that balances spicy heat with sweet and tangy flavors. Perfect for entertaining and pairs wonderfully with cream cheese and crackers.
Always wear gloves when handling jalapeños to avoid irritation. Stir continuously when adding pectin to prevent lumps. Use the cold plate wrinkle test to check jelly set. Do not skip the water bath canning step to ensure safe preservation. Let jars cool undisturbed for 12-24 hours before storing. For a milder jelly, remove seeds or substitute with milder peppers. For a low-sugar version, use low-sugar pectin and reduce sugar by half, noting texture changes.
